Rear Admiral Alexis T. Walker

Rear Adm. Alexis “Lex” T. Walker is a native of the Bronx, New York, and began his naval service in 1989 by entering the Broadened Opportunity for Officer Selection and Training (BOOST) Program. Upon completing BOOST, he attended Jacksonville University, where he ear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in Broadcast Communications and was commissioned via the Naval Reserve Officers Training Corps (NROTC) in December 1994. He earned a Master of Arts degree in Organizational Management from The George Washington University and a Master of Arts degree in National Security and Strategic Studies from the U.S. Naval War College Fleet Seminar Program. 

Walker has served at sea as communications officer and first lieutenant aboard USS Robert G. Bradley (FFG 49); main propulsion assistant and training officer aboard USS Hayler (DD 997); engineer officer aboard USS Cole (DDG 67) and USS Leyte Gulf (CG 55); executive officer of USS Bulkeley (DDG 84); commanding officer of USS Stockdale (DDG 106); and as deputy and commodore of Destroyer Squadron (DESRON) 7.

His shore tours include service as a Destroyer/Cruiser Gas Turbine Instructor at Surface Warfare Officers School Command (SWOS); a Navy Washington, D.C. intern; Post-Department Head Detailer (PERS-411C) at Navy Personnel Command; Deputy for Congressional Affairs at U.S. European Command; Warfare Integration Branch Head in OPNAV N9I; Senior Military Assistant to the Secretary of the Navy; Deputy Chief of Legislative Affairs at the Navy Office of Legislative Affairs; and Commanding Officer, Surface Warfare Schools Command. 

Walker’s initial flag tour was as Commander, Navy Recruiting Command. Walker is currently serving as Commander, Carrier Strike Group TEN.
